Ticket ENG-SYNC item: Consent banner rollout blocked — vault locked

So the BannerWise consent rollout is stuck. The config vault holding the regional consent templates auto-locked after Friday's failed deploy (three bad auth attempts from the CI runner, classic). Legal wants the new banner live in the Veltria region by end of week, so this is now the top blocker. Darragh confirmed the vault itself is healthy — it just needs a manual unseal. To unlock it, use the recovery passphrase below.

unlock words, yawig-kagef: gordor-holvan-ulaael-pramir-ulaiel-tamdor

Handover — Director transition, Ostara Manufacturing

Tomas: budget request for the Hollowbrook line expansion is with Finance. Ask is 2.4M, split across tooling and hiring. CFO wants headcount justified separately. Capex committee meets in three weeks; slides are drafted, numbers need your sign-off. Push back on the 15% contingency — they'll try to cut it. Ravi has the sensitivity models. Do not share the expansion rationale beyond Finance. Context on why timing matters sits directly below.

board note of bawep-tajef: Queniusek Systems plans to raise the Quenvan list price by 53.1 percent in March. The pricing group signed off on a budget of $176.4 million for Project Drueth. The renewal with Casionix Partners closes at $142.5 million a year, 8.3 percent below the last contract. Project Fraax slips by six weeks because of the tooling delay.

Ticket: Missed collection — prototype hardware to Vellmore Test Lab

The scheduled courier did not arrive for the Kestrel-9 prototype units packed at Bay 3. All six units remain in their anti-static cases, seals verified and logged. A replacement collection has been rebooked for tomorrow, 09:30, same dock. Receiving staff should verify seal numbers against the manifest on arrival. The courier hand-over instruction appears immediately below.

courier memo of yahif-faweg: the quenael tamius courier leaves the prawyn jorix kaswyn istox silmir brieth zormir fenvan ledger at gate 3145 under passcode 231062